Lines Matching refs:clearval
2874 static u32 hclge_check_event_cause(struct hclge_dev *hdev, u32 *clearval) in hclge_check_event_cause() argument
2896 *clearval = BIT(HCLGE_VECTOR0_IMPRESET_INT_B); in hclge_check_event_cause()
2905 *clearval = BIT(HCLGE_VECTOR0_GLOBALRESET_INT_B); in hclge_check_event_cause()
2914 *clearval = msix_src_reg; in hclge_check_event_cause()
2921 *clearval = cmdq_src_reg; in hclge_check_event_cause()
2929 *clearval = msix_src_reg; in hclge_check_event_cause()
2966 u32 clearval = 0; in hclge_misc_irq_handle() local
2970 event_cause = hclge_check_event_cause(hdev, &clearval); in hclge_misc_irq_handle()
3008 hclge_clear_event_cause(hdev, event_cause, clearval); in hclge_misc_irq_handle()
3015 if (!clearval || in hclge_misc_irq_handle()
3439 u32 clearval = 0; in hclge_clear_reset_cause() local
3443 clearval = BIT(HCLGE_VECTOR0_IMPRESET_INT_B); in hclge_clear_reset_cause()
3446 clearval = BIT(HCLGE_VECTOR0_GLOBALRESET_INT_B); in hclge_clear_reset_cause()
3452 if (!clearval) in hclge_clear_reset_cause()
3460 clearval); in hclge_clear_reset_cause()